Bottom two and belts to the right came from a championship four pack released exclusively through Toys R Us in 1997. It included The Undertaker (World), The Rock (IC), and Owen and Bulldog (2 Tags and Euro).

The sculpted belts are from the Championship Title Series #1 4-pack released in late 1997 as a TRU exclusive (as was mentioned before). These belts were only released once, so they could be considered hard to find. The other tag team title belts were originally available in the Off The Mat 4-pack and were displayed around the waists of the New Age Outlaws. The blue Attitude Era Heavyweight and purple Intercontinental title belts were also made with Stone Cold and The Rock (respectively) in the same set. The belts were released again in the Championship Title Series #2 4-pack with X-Pac and Kane (also, the Attitude Era Heavyweight title came with The Rock and Stone Cold came with the one and only Smoking Skull Heavyweight title belt). And, the belts were released one last time in a Deluxe Grapple Gear pack called "Total Attitude" which was exclusive to TRU stores. In fact, everything mentioned was exclusive to TRU stores. The belts in loose, used condition are worth no more than $2-3 each, but more buyers will be interested in buying them together as one lot (with or without the ToyBiz WCW title belt).
